Summary
HCL IEM does not enforce strict transport security (HSTS), allowing attackers to perform SSL stripping or man-in-the-middle attacks, compromising secure communications.
Risk Assessment
The risk is that attackers can intercept and modify network traffic, potentially leading to theft of credentials or other sensitive information.
Recommendation
It is recommended to enable and enforce the Strict-Transport-Security (HSTS) header on the server and redirect all HTTP traffic to HTTPS.
